Routine dental exams are essential for maintaining long-term oral health, allowing dentists to catch potential issues early through visual inspections, digital radiography, and personalized consultations. During these visits, patients can expect a thorough examination of their teeth and gums, discussions on brushing and flossing techniques, and recommendations for preventive measures like sealants or fluoride treatments. These exams also play a crucial role in fostering a proactive approach to oral care, ensuring that any concerns are addressed before they become more serious issues.
